Focusing on themes of recovery from betrayal and addiction, this podcast features in-depth conversations between two therapists who are also brothers. They tackle complex emotional issues faced by individuals navigating relationships affected by addiction, emphasizing healing, trust restoration, and personal growth. Episodes cover a variety of topics, such as coping with infidelity, strengthening emotional connections, and understanding the dynamics of co-parenting amidst personal challenges. Each discussion invites real-life callers to share their struggles, allowing listeners to gain insights from their experiences while offering practical guidance aimed at overcoming emotional hurdles.
